It nudges checkout prices by a few
// basis points for half of traffic. If conversion dashboards look
// weird, this is probably why — it's intentional, don't revert at 3am.
// Kill switch is the `driftwood_enabled` flag; flipping it off is safe
// and reversible. Changes here must go through the pricing review
// queue, no exceptions. The experiment build is identified by the
// token below.

build token for kagaf-hahof: htk14_9d3d4d26d7d8de

Quarterly Planning Note — Pilot with Drennal Market Group

Branch managers: the pilot with Drennal Market Group begins in early Q2 across six of their stores in the Ostwick corridor. We will supply Lumehive shelf units and weekly replenishment; their staff handle merchandising. Expect slightly higher pick volumes at the Ferrow Lane depot during the first month. Success metrics are sell-through rate and return frequency, reviewed at week six. Do not discuss terms with Drennal staff directly. The confidential commercial context appears below.

internal memo for taguf-kafop: Novmirax Group plans to lower the Oliius list price by 42.0 percent in March. The board signed off on a budget of $367.8 million for Project Belael. The renewal with Drumirax Logistics closes at $302.4 million a year, 54.0 percent below the last contract. Project Kelys slips by a full year because of the staffing delay.

## Escalation — Trailform Offline Mode

When field-survey devices fail to sync after reconnecting, first check the sync-queue dashboard for stuck batches. Stuck longer than 30 minutes: requeue via the admin console. Data-loss reports from surveyors are always Sev2 — do not attempt local fixes. Conflict-resolution bugs go to the mobile platform rotation. For sync escalations outside business hours, contact the on-call alias.

billing contact of tahaf-kafop = istwyn_fraox@norvaworks.corp